Lakeridge Health is more than a hospital. It is a health network that includes five hospitals, a long-term care home, a community-based surgical centre, and more than 30 community sites across the Durham Region. Guided by our vision of One System.

Best Health. and supported by a dedicated team of nearly 9,000 staff, physicians, and volunteers, Lakeridge Health is a place where the best people want to start, grow, and finish their careers in health care. Duties And Responsibilities

Strategic Leadership &

- Telecommunications Management

- Develop and execute operational strategies for Telecommunications services that align with organizational objectives, patient care requirements, labour obligations, and IT service delivery goals.
- Establish and monitor key performance indicators, service level agreements, service standards, and operational metrics to promote reliable and consistent service delivery.
- Develop, maintain, and continuously improve telecommunications policies, procedures, standards, and escalation pathways.
- Lead service improvement initiatives through operational data, incident trends, stakeholder feedback, and recognized healthcare and telecommunications practices.
- Ensure operational readiness for emergency communications, downtime response, disaster recovery, and business continuity activities.
- Manage relationships with telecommunications vendors, carriers, and service providers, including service performance, issue escalation, and contract compliance.
- Provide input to budget planning and forecasts and monitor expenditures related to Telecommunications services, staffing, equipment, supplies, and service contracts.

Operational Excellence &
- Service Delivery

- Lead the daily operation of a 24/7 unionized Telecommunications team and ensure responsive, accurate, and respectful service for patients, families, staff, physicians, and external callers.
- Oversee hospital switchboard services, emergency code activations, paging services, physician and staff on-call communication, automated call routing, emergency notification, mass communication, and supported mobile communication workflows.
- Monitor call volumes, response and wait times, abandonment rates, service levels, emergency communication response times, quality indicators, and customer feedback.
- Act as the senior operational escalation point for service disruptions and complex telecommunications incidents, coordinating timely response and stakeholder communication.
- Ensure physician directories, call schedules, escalation pathways, departmental contacts, and related operational information remain accurate and current.
- Maintain the Telecommunications Knowledge Base, standard operating procedures, downtime documentation, and training materials.
- Coordinate telecommunications service restoration and contingency workflows during outages and downtime events.
- Provide operational reports and analysis to support departmental and organizational decision-making.
